Tycoon says Beckhams slandered him

LONDON, March 24 (UPI) -- A British nightlife tycoon has sued David and Victoria Beckham for slander after paying heavily to attend their World Cup party last year.

Dave West says that he heard that the couple called him "unsavory." He bought two tickets to the party through a charity auction for 103,000 pounds ($200,000).

West, 63, stayed away from the Full Length and Fabulous Ball last May after he was told he could not wear his usual trademark clothing, a pink suit, the Evening Standard reported.

A judge ruled Friday that the Beckhams, the soccer star and the former singer Posh Spice, could not be held liable for breach of contract because the party was actually put together by a company set up specifically for the event. But he allowed the slander claim to stand.

"If true, he was treated in a rather shabby way," Justice Charles Gray said.

West told reporters after the hearing that he did not understand why Beckham treated him so badly given that they share working class origins.

"I deal with people from all walks of life and have never been treated in so shabby and disrespectful a manner," West said. "I am more saint than unsavory."
